Here, a map with icons representing each of the people who have chosen to share their location with you will appear, along with a list of their names, distance from you, and how long ago they were at the displayed location. If you click on the far left ‘People’ tab, you’ll find a tool that is almost identical to what used to be ‘Find my Friends’. For further peace of mind, there is also the option to disable ‘offline finding’ in the settings app. Apple has ensured that not even they themselves are able to intercept and leverage the geolocation data. To decrypt this data, you’ll need a device logged in to your Apple ID and protected with two-factor authentication. Offline tracking requires at least two Apple devices, each emitting a constantly changing public key that nearby devices pick up, encrypt, and then upload.

This does require that the device is switched on with Bluetooth enabled, but essentially, this update means your devices are more traceable than ever.Īt the time of launch this caused concerns around potential breaches of privacy, which Apple responded to by ensuring the feature has a secure encryption system that prevents people from abusing it by, say, tracking your location without consent. Apple has designed an innovative system that instead leverages Bluetooth and allows nearby Apple devices to talk to your lost device and send back details of its location. One major update that iOS 13 brought to ‘Find My’ was the ability to locate devices even when they aren’t connected to WiFi or an LTE network. This makes the device unable to activate without the correct Apple ID and password, meaning it is far more difficult for a thief to use or sell. If this doesn’t work, or you are convinced that your phone, tablet or laptop has fallen into the wrong hands, Apple will allow you to erase the device completely and destroy any data it stores by implementing the ‘Activation Lock’. Marking your device as lost sets in motion comprehensive safety measures – the device will completely lock, Apple Pay will be disabled, and you’ll be given the option to display contact information on the screen to help anyone who finds your device to return it safely back to you. These include getting directions to the device, playing a sound to help locate the device in close proximity, marking the device as lost, and, in more extreme cases, completely erasing the device and restoring it back to factory settings. Tapping on a device icon you have lost will give you multiple handy options to help you locate it. Immediately on entering the Find My app you’ll see three tabs, ‘People’ on the left, ‘Devices’ in the middle, and ‘Me’ on the right.Ĭlicking on the ‘Devices’ tab in the middle will make your Apple gadgets appear on a map with icons representing each one. As long as you’re signed on to iCloud and have the Find My feature enabled, you will be able to locate any lost devices through the app. Almost all Apple products are compatible, including Macs, iPhones, AirPods, Apple Watches and iPads.

Most of the functionality of the app has remained the same, except for the fact that functionality is now all in a single application and can be found at the press of a single button.īelow we discuss how Find My iPhone and Find My Friends can be useful, as well as how to navigate the latest changes within the new ‘Find My’ app.įind My iPhone is a feature that allows users to find an Apple device, simply by signing in to iCloud.

However, the launch of iOS 13 brought with it many new software updates across the entire range of compatible Apple devices, one of them being that Find My iPhone and Find My Friends were merged into one app, now named ‘Find My’. How to use ‘Find My iPhone’ and ‘Find My Friends’įind My iPhone and Find My Friends have been a part of the Apple ‘own-brand’ app portfolio since 20 respectively, and have, up until September 2019, existed separately as individual apps.
